Dubai Municipality, officially known as the Dubai Municipality Authority, is a pivotal institution headquartered in the United Arab Emirates (AE). Established in 1954, it has played a crucial role in shaping the urban landscape of Dubai, overseeing various operational regions across the emirate. As a key player in the public sector, Dubai Municipality operates within the urban planning and environmental management industries, focusing on essential services such as waste management, public health, and infrastructure development. Its commitment to sustainability and innovation has positioned it as a leader in municipal services, with notable achievements in enhancing the quality of life for residents and visitors alike. With a strong emphasis on community welfare and environmental stewardship, Dubai Municipality continues to set benchmarks in service delivery, making it a cornerstone of Dubai's rapid development and urban excellence.

Dubai Municipality's reported carbon emissions

In 2023, Dubai Municipality reported total carbon emissions of approximately 3,790,207,000 kg CO2e, with Scope 1 emissions accounting for about 3,555,204,000 kg CO2e and Scope 2 emissions at approximately 235,003,000 kg CO2e. This marks a slight increase from 2022, when total emissions were about 3,535,797,000 kg CO2e, with Scope 1 emissions at approximately 49,408,000 kg CO2e and Scope 2 emissions at around 240,099,000 kg CO2e. Dubai Municipality is actively aligning its efforts with Dubai’s Carbon Abatement Strategy 2030, which aims to achieve a 30% reduction in CO2 emissions by 2030 for both Scope 1 and Scope 2 emissions. This commitment reflects a proactive approach to climate action, contributing to the UAE's broader climate goals. Looking towards the future, Dubai Municipality is also working towards the UAE’s net zero emissions vision for 2050, indicating a long-term commitment to sustainability and climate resilience. The organisation has not disclosed any Scope 3 emissions data, focusing primarily on its direct and indirect emissions from operations. Overall, Dubai Municipality's emissions data and climate commitments underscore its dedication to reducing its carbon footprint and supporting national climate strategies.
